From the author of the celebrated and bestselling memoir Blue Blood (β€œMay be the best account ever written of life behind the badge.” β€”Time) comes this highly anticipated fiction debut. In Red on Red, Edward Conlon tells the story of two NYPD detectives, Meehan and Esposito: one damaged and introspective, the other ambitious and unscrupulous. Meehan is compelled by haunting and elusive stories that defy easy resolution, while Esposito is drawn to cases of rough and ordinary combat. A fierce and unlikely friendship develops between them and plays out against a tangle of mysteries: a lonely immigrant who hangs herself in Inwood Hill Park, a serial rapist preying on upper Manhattan, a troubled Catholic schoolgirl who appears in the wrong place with uncanny regularity, and a savage gang war that erupts over a case of mistaken identity.

Red on Red captures the vibrant dynamic of a successful police partnershipβ€”the tests of loyalty, the necessary betrayals, the wedding of life and workβ€”and tells an unrelenting and exciting story that captures the grittiness, complexity, ironies, and compromises of life on the job.
